[ANNOUNCE] Apache CXF 3.4.0 Released!

The Apache CXF Team is pleased to announce the release of Apache CXF 3.4.0!

Apache CXF is a services framework that helps you build and develop web services using standards based API’s and protocols.   Services can be created and consumed using the JAX-WS or JAX-RS API’s and can run using a variety of protocols and transports such as SOAP, JMS, HTTP, etc…

Apache CXF 3.4.0 has several new features:

• New cxf-bom artifactId for importing all the CXF artifacts
• New support for Microprofile OpenAPI (as alternative to Swagger Core 2.0)
• New samples to show WS-Transaction usage, OpenAPI v3.0 with Microprofile
• Ability in Logging feature to mask sensitive information
• New support for SSEs in Microprofile Rest Client
• OAuth 2.0 Authorization Server Metadata / OpenID Provider Metadata


There are also a TON of third party dependency updates and other changes to keep up with all the other projects CXF leverages.   Some of those updates may have impacts so users are encouraged to check the migration guide to help guide them in the upgrade process.
